Hormonal optimization represents a highly individualized science, a bespoke program for recalibrating your internal operating system. The process begins with a comprehensive, data-driven assessment. This involves advanced blood panels, moving far beyond standard wellness checks to evaluate a broad spectrum of biomarkers. Understanding these unique physiological signatures provides a precise roadmap for targeted interventions.

A thorough initial assessment typically includes evaluating key hormonal markers. Specific analyses cover total and free testosterone, estradiol, progesterone, DHEA-S, thyroid hormones (TSH, Free T3, Free T4), cortisol, and growth factors like IGF-1. This data paints a clear picture of the endocrine landscape, pinpointing areas where strategic recalibration yields the most significant improvements. This precision ensures protocols align perfectly with individual needs.

Peptide therapy represents another highly targeted approach within biological optimization. These short chains of amino acids function as precise signaling molecules within the body. They instruct cells to perform specific actions, ranging from promoting cellular repair to modulating hormone release. Unlike broad hormonal interventions, peptides often target very specific pathways, offering a nuanced method for enhancing performance and recovery.

Consider Releasing Peptides (GHRHs) such as Sermorelin and Ipamorelin. These compounds stimulate the body’s natural production of growth hormone. The result can manifest in improved body composition, faster recovery from physical exertion, enhanced sleep quality, and even cognitive benefits. They provide a sophisticated method for supporting restorative processes without introducing exogenous growth hormone directly.

BPC-157, another compelling peptide, demonstrates powerful regenerative properties. This particular compound excels at accelerating tissue repair, reducing inflammation, and supporting gut health. Athletes and individuals recovering from physical stress find it invaluable for its precise effects on healing pathways. Protocol/Compound Primary Function/Mechanism General Benefits (Illustrative)
Testosterone Recalibration Protocol Restoring optimal androgen levels; enhancing protein synthesis Increased muscle mass, reduced body fat, elevated energy, improved mood, enhanced cognitive drive
Sermorelin/Ipamorelin (GHRHs) Stimulates natural growth hormone release from pituitary gland Enhanced recovery, improved sleep quality, better body composition, collagen synthesis
BPC-157 Accelerates tissue repair; reduces inflammation; supports gut lining integrity Faster healing of injuries (tendons, ligaments), reduced pain, improved digestive health
DHEA Optimization Supports adrenal function; precursor to other hormones Increased energy, mood stabilization, improved stress response, libido support
Thyroid Optimization Regulates metabolism, energy production, body temperature Metabolic efficiency, sustained energy levels, cognitive clarity, mood regulation
